5 No-Frills Restaurants in South Gate, California that Serve the Best Food You’ll Ever Taste

South Gate is part of the vibrant fabric of Southeast Los Angeles, a place where culinary authenticity is everything.

The city’s food scene is a paradise of incredible, family-run Mexican restaurants and classic American diners.

The best food here is served from taco trucks, small storefronts, and decades-old establishments on Tweedy Boulevard.

This isn’t about trends; it’s about tradition, flavor, and community.

Here are five no-frills restaurants in South Gate that serve the best food you’ll ever taste.

1. Tacos El Unico

Tacos El Unico is a Southeast LA institution, and the South Gate location is a local landmark.

This is a classic, no-nonsense taqueria that has been serving consistently amazing tacos for decades.

Whether you get the carne asada, al pastor, or cabeza, the flavor is always on point.

It’s the benchmark for a traditional, no-frills taco experience in the area.

2. Rigo’s Tacos

Rigo’s is another heavyweight in the local taco scene, serving up delicious Mexican food 24 hours a day.

It’s the go-to spot for late-night cravings or a hearty breakfast burrito to start the day.

The menu is extensive, the service is fast, and the food is always reliable and delicious.

It’s a cornerstone of the South Gate community.

3. Tweedy’s Restaurant

Tweedy’s is a classic coffee shop and diner that feels like it hasn’t changed in 50 years.

It’s a beloved local gathering place on the city’s main drag, Tweedy Boulevard.

The menu is a mix of American diner classics and homestyle Mexican favorites.

It’s an authentic, unpretentious spot that serves the heart and soul of the community.

4. Tacos Don Goyo

Tacos Don Goyo is a smaller, family-owned spot that has earned a huge following for its incredible quality.

Locals rave about the freshness of the ingredients and the perfectly seasoned meats.

The focus is purely on the food, served simply and with pride.

It’s a perfect example of a hidden gem that delivers some of the best tacos in the area.

5. La Casita Mexicana

Located just next door in Bell, La Casita Mexicana is so essential to the region it must be included.

Run by celebrated chefs, this restaurant serves elevated, yet traditional, Mexican cuisine in a colorful, homey setting.

Despite the national acclaim, it has retained its no-frills, neighborhood soul.

The food is a vibrant celebration of Mexican regional flavors.
